Lamborghini Marks Record Delivery Performance In 2025
10,747 vehicles were delivered worldwide despite challenging market conditions.

Automobili Lamborghini closed 2025 with its strongest performance to date, once again surpassing the 10,000-unit milestone and setting a new all-time delivery record. The Sant’Agata Bolognese marque delivered 10,747 vehicles worldwide, improving on the previous year and reinforcing strong global demand, particularly for its new generation of hybrid models.

Sant’Agata Bolognese, 20 January 2026 – The result confirms both Lamborghini’s continued growth and the success of its hybridisation strategy, which has been enthusiastically received by customers across all major markets.
Commenting on the achievement, Chairman and CEO Stephan Winkelmann highlighted the significance of the results amid challenging market conditions. He noted that Lamborghini’s performance reflects disciplined strategic decision-making and a clear understanding of evolving customer expectations, with the brand focused on sustainable growth rather than chasing volume peaks.

Deliveries remained well balanced across regions. EMEA continued to lead with 4,650 units delivered, followed by the Americas with 3,347 vehicles and the Asia Pacific region with 2,750 units. Key contributors to the year’s performance were Revuelto, Lamborghini’s first V12 HPEV hybrid super sports car, and Urus SE, the plug-in hybrid version of its Super SUV. Both models mark the beginning of the brand’s electrification journey, which will be further expanded in 2026 with the arrival of Temerario. Following its dynamic debut at the Estoril circuit in August, customer deliveries of Temerario begin in January, with orders already covering around twelve months. This completes Lamborghini’s transition to an entirely hybridised model range, a first among luxury super sports car manufacturers.
The year was also marked by two notable product debuts. At the Goodwood Festival of Speed in July, Lamborghini unveiled the Temerario GT3, the first racing derivative of the Temerario programme and the first race car fully designed, developed and built by Lamborghini Squadra Corse. The car is set to compete in major global GT3 championships from 2026.

In August, during Monterey Car Week, Lamborghini revealed Fenomeno, an ultra-limited series of just 29 examples. Powered by the most powerful V12 engine ever produced by the brand and integrated into a hybrid system delivering a combined 1,080 CV, Fenomeno represents the pinnacle of Lamborghini’s performance and engineering capabilities.
The model also introduces a new design manifesto, pushing the brand’s iconic styling language to new extremes, and made its debut in the same year Lamborghini Centro Stile celebrated its 20th anniversary.
